Federal Insurance Owes $6M In Housing Bias Suit Coverage
By Gavin Broady ( September 25, 2012, 1:50 PM EDT) -- A California appeals court ruled Monday that excess and umbrella insurance carrier Federal Insurance Co. must cover $6 million in defense costs incurred by another insurer in connection with a U.S. Department of Justice housing discrimination suit....
